LOGIN SECURITY Two-factor authentication (TFA) – Require TFA for specific user roles. Supports Google Authenticator, Microsoft Authenticator, Authy, and many more. Detect and manage ‘admin’ usernames – Identify default ‘admin’ usernames and guide users to change them to protect against brute force attacks. Identify and correct identical login and display names – Detect cases where the display name matches the username and provide guidance to improve login security. Prevent user enumeration – Block unauthorised access to URLs that can reveal sensitive information such as usernames or other details. Control login attempts – Prevent brute force attacks by limiting the number of failed login attempts. Choose how many login attempts are allowed, set lockout durations, and more. Force user logout – Automatically log out users after a specified period of time. Unattended sessions are closed, reducing the risk of unauthorised access. Manually approve new registrations – Review and approve new user registrations to prevent spam and fake sign-ups. Enhance WordPress salt security – Adds 64 extra characters to WordPress salts, rotating them weekly. Makes cracking passwords virtually impossible, even if your database is stolen. SPAM PREVENTION Block spam coming from bots – Reduce the load on your server and improve the user experience by automatically blocking spam comments from bots. Monitor spam IP addresses – Monitor the IP addresses of people or bots leaving spam comments. Choose which ones to block based on a configurable number of comments left. FILE / DATABASE Security Scan and fix file permissions – Scan for insecure file permissions. Click once to fix issues and safeguard critical files and folders. Disable PHP file editing – Disable editing of PHP files (such as plugins and themes) via the dashboard. It’s often the first tool that attackers use as it allows for code execution. Protect sensitive files – Prevent access to files like readme.html that might reveal information about your WordPress installation. File change scanner – Get notified of any file changes which occur on your system. Exclude files and folders which change as part of normal operations. Prevent image hotlinking – Prevent other websites from displaying your images via hotlinking and protect server bandwidth. Secure database backups – Perform a database backup via UpdraftPlus from AIOS. Change the default ‘wp_’ prefix to hide your WordPress database from hackers. FIREWALL Get .htaccess firewall rules – Deny access to the .htaccess and wp-config.php files. Disable the server signature and limit file uploads to a configurable size.** Block access to the debug.log file and prevent Apache servers from listing the contents of a directory when an index.php file is not present Get PHP firewall rules – PHP firewall rules prevent malicious users from exploiting well-known vulnerabilities in XML-RPC. Safeguard your content by disabling RSS and Atom feeds and avoid c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ks. Block fake Google bots and POST requests made by bots – Block fake Google bots and stop bots from making POST requests by blocking IP addresses where the user-agent and referrer fields are blank. Utilise 6G firewall rules – Employ flexible blacklist rules to reduce the number of malicious URL requests that hit your website (courtesy of Perishable Press). And more – Blacklist (and whitelist) IP ranges and user agents and block unauthorized access to data by disabling REST API access for non-logged-in requests. SMART 404 BLOCKING [Premium] Block IPs based on 404 errors – Detect hackers probing your URLs via script and bots by the 404 errors they leave behind. Smart 404 Configuration – Set a figure for the maximum number of 404 events allowed before an IP address is blocked. Choose a time period within which the 404 events must occur (e.g., 10 errors within 10 minutes). Smart 404 block by URL string – Instantly block an IP address if a 404 event includes a specific URL string. Smart 404 whitelisting – Prevent particular IP addresses from being permanently blocked due to 404 events. CloudSecure WP Securityは、管理画面とログインURLをサイバー攻撃から守る、国産・日本語対応のセキュリティ対策プラグインです。 簡単な設定だけで、不正アクセスや不正ログインからWordPressを保護し、サイトのセキュリティを高めます。 各機能は有効/無効を切り替えるだけで設定でき、必要な対策をわかりやすく管理できます。シンプルで扱いやすい設計のため、日々のサイト運用にも取り入れやすいプラグインです。 ※ 本プラグインは日本国内の利用者向けに提供しているものであり、EU居住者を対象とした提供は意図していません。 ドキュメントやFAQなど、より詳細な情報は こちら でご覧いただけます。 WordPressのマルチサイト機能には対応していません。 WebサーバーはApache2.xでの動作を確認済みです。 画像認証追加機能を利用するためには、PHPに拡張ライブラリ「gd」をインストールする必要があります。 管理画面アクセス制限機能、ログインURL変更機能を利用するためには、Apacheに「mod_rewrite」を読み込む必要があります。 本プラグインの機能は以下のとおりです。 ログイン無効化 指定した期間内に指定した回数ログインに失敗した場合、指定した時間ログインを無効化(ブロック)します。 ブルートフォースアタックやパスワードリスト攻撃など、不正なログインを試みる攻撃を防ぐための機能です。 とくに、自動化された攻撃に有効です。 ログインURL変更 ログインURL(wp-login.php)を変更します。 半角英小文字、半角数字、ハイフン、アンダースコアのいずれかを使用し、4文字以上12文字以下でお好みの名前(文字列)に設定できます。 ブルートフォースアタックやパスワードリスト攻撃など、不正なログインを試みる攻撃を受けにくくするための機能です。 ログインエラーメッセージ統一 ログイン時、ユーザー名、パスワード、画像認証のどれを間違えても同一のメッセージを表示します。 ユーザー名の存在を調査する攻撃を受けにくくするための機能です。 2段階認証 ログイン時、ユーザー名とパスワードの入力に加え、別のコードで追加認証を行います。 認証方法はGoogle Authenticator またはメール認証のいずれかを選択できます。 各認証方法で生成された6桁の認証コードをログイン画面で入力し、すべての情報が一致すればログインできます。 ユーザー名やパスワードを不正入手した第三者によるログインやなりすましを防止し、セキュリティを強化します。 画像認証追加 画像データ上にランダムに表示される文字の入力を求め、一致しなければ次の画面に進めないようにする機能です。 ログインフォーム、コメントフォーム、パスワードリセットフォーム、ユーザー登録フォームに設定できます。 ブルートフォースアタックやパスワードリスト攻撃などの不正なログインを試みる攻撃や、悪意のあるプログラムからの機械的な不正アクセスを防止する機能です。 ユーザー名漏えい防止 「?author=数字」アクセスによるユーザー名の漏えいを防止します。 XML-RPC無効化 XML-RPC機能、またはピンバック機能を無効化し、その乱用から管理画面を保護します。 REST API無効化 REST APIを無効化し、その悪用から管理画面を守ります。 管理画面アクセス制限 管理画面にログインしていない接続元IPアドレスから管理ページ(/wp-admin/以降)にアクセスすると、404エラー(Not Found)を返します。 24時間以上管理画面にログインしていない接続元IPアドレスが対象です。 ログインすると接続元IPアドレスが記録され、管理画面にアクセスできるようになります。 この機能を除外するページ(wp-admin以下)を指定できます。 設定ファイルアクセス防止 WordPressのシステムに関するファイルへの不正アクセスを遮断する機能です。 シンプルWAF WordPressへの攻撃に対して、基本的な防御機能を備えたシンプルなWAF(Web Application Firewall)機能です。 SQLインジェクションやクロスサイトスクリプティングなどの一般的な攻撃を遮断します。 ログイン通知 ログインがあったとき、ユーザーにメールで通知します。 心当たりのないメールを受信した場合、不正なログインを疑ってください。 アップデート通知 WordPress、プラグイン、テーマの更新が必要になったとき、WordPressの管理者ユーザーにメールで通知します。 更新の確認は24時間ごとに行われます。 常に最新版を使用することが、セキュリティの基本です。 サーバーエラー通知 サーバーエラー「HTTPステータスコード500(Internal Server Error)」が発生したとき、エラーの履歴を記録し、WordPressの管理者ユーザーにメールで通知します。 1時間以内に同じタイプのエラーが発生した場合、エラーの履歴は記録しますが、メールでの通知は行いません。 ログイン履歴 管理画面にログインした履歴を表示します。 それぞれの項目で絞り込んでの検索も可能です。 ログイン通知と同様、不正なログインの気づきを促す機能です。
